The Zimbabwe Congress of Trade Union has called for all teachers to strike starting on Monday the 22nd of June on reasons of government not being transparent about the Covid 19 funds meant for Teachers Allowances.

Speaking in a Press Conference ZCTU said that they will not tolerate ZANU PF feeding their families and turning their children into millionaires with funds meant for teachers.

ZCTU says they are not calling for a Mass Action for themselves as an organisation but for the teacher’s families who will suffer under an unfair government.

This comes after The Zimbabwean government through the ministry of Finance decided to pay civil servants in US Dollars starting end of June this month as Covid 19 allowance.
